Taxonomic Classification

Rank Mesquite Pacific Flying Fox
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Fabales (Legumes & Allies) Chiroptera (Bats)
Family Fabaceae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ats)
Genus Prosopis Pteropus (Flying Foxes)
Species Prosopis juliflora Pteropus tonganus

Habitat & Geographic Range

Mesquite

Habitat

Inhabits flooded grasslands and savannas and deserts and xeric shrublands within the Afrotropic biogeographic realm.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.

Range

Widely distributed across Africa (29 countries), Asia (23 countries), Europe (4 countries), North America (13 countries), Oceania and the Pacific (Australia), and South America (Bolivia, Brazil, Colombia).
